FABULOUS! I discovered this beautiful resort spa few month ago when I had conference at this property. I’m very impressed with the spa decor. I had a Body Sculpting Treatment on my tummy area. The technician did a measuring of before and after treatments on my tummy. I lost 3/4 inch on the high point, 1 1/2 inches on my middle point, another 1 1/2 on the lower point. Totally I lost about 3 inches right after the service. Compared this treatment to another body wrap I had, this had a noticeable result and was much more relaxing. . It was a “ WOW” to me and I really enjoyed this Gem.
Also, I had their signature massage that incorporates a customizing massage with warm stones. The massage therapist was very experienced and the heated stones’ warmth went deep down into the tension area of my back. My goodness, I was in the heaven. I LOVE IT and I’ll be back soon.

I had a Being Anti-aging facial last weekend and it was one of my best facial experiences ever. It?s been a week and I still can tell their facial has the best lasting result. My skin is really much more smoother and tighter than other facials that I have had.
Another great thing about this resort spa is the use of the hotel amenities.
I really like the exotic design of the co-ed indoor Jacuzzi and their relaxation lounge. A 75 minutes anti aging facial with a complimentary resort spa pass for $125--it is really affordable for my monthly facial routine and well worth it . I will continue my facial regiment with them.
